. A dictionary of the fossils of Pennsylvania and neighboring states named in the reports and catalogues of the survey ... Paleontology. Oast. 186. Cystiphyllum sulcatum. Compare Coleophyllum pyri- forme. Villa. Cystiphyllum vesiculosum. (Goldfuss.) A widely dis- tri bu te d species on both sides of the Atlan- tic. (Nich- olson. Pal. of Ontario, 1874, p. 37.) CoUett's In- diana Re- port of 1881, page 391, plate 55, ... ^^ figs. 1,2, two â ^ specimens with much of their skin (epitheca) dissolved, drawn by Van Oleve.âForm very variable; but sack or little bladder-like interior structure always well marked. Characteristic of the Devonian rochs. VIII, Cystiphyllum ? in the Genesee coral led (No. 8) of the section at Mapleton, Huntingdon Co. (T3, 273)âF///6. Cystiphyllum. ? in the Hamilton upper shale coral bed, 120' beneath what is supposed by I. C. White to be Tully limestone, in the Cove station section, in Huntingdon Co., Pa.
